The SBIR/STTR Program

PCG, Inc. offers expert support in the competitive SBIR/STTR program. From concept to submission, we help drive the process and translate your ideas into agency requirements. The SBIR/STTR program offers the largest source of early-stage technology financing in the nation, with more than $2 billion awarded annually and PCG, Inc. offers experience working on proposals to all 11 participating agencies.

Kristen Parmelee

After more than 15 years as a consultant, PCG, Inc. has developed long-term relationships with many of its clients. It’s not just about a single project; it’s about creating opportunities for meaningful engagement and growth—for both PCG, Inc. and the client.

Kristen (Kris) Parmelee is a proud graduate of Indiana University’s School of Public and Environmental Affairs (SPEA). She started her career at an Indianapolis-based nonprofit in program development and management.  After gaining initial experience in fund raising, Kris launched her own venture in 2000 with a focus on private foundation and federal grants.  In 2005, she expanded her experience to include SBIR/STTR and for the past five years, has focused almost exclusively on SBIR/STTR and project management services.
